Understanding temperature-induced primary nucleation in dual impinging jet mixers

Primary nucleation in cooling dual impinging jet (DIJ) mixers is analyzed.

The DIJ mixers generate supersaturation by combining hot and cold liquid solutions.

Spatial distributions are derived for temperature and supersaturation.

High local supersaturation can occur near the interface of hot and cold solutions.

Criteria are given for assessing feasibility of nucleation for specific compounds.
